Police in the northern town of Elblag have taken three women into custody after they allegedly burgled apartments belonging to men whom they had previously seduced in the street.

It is reported that the women went for men between the ages of 60 and 80, and after charming them in downtown Elblag they would propose to go back home to the men’s apartments.

“Many of the seduced men were burgled as the women would persuade them to take them back home,” police spokesman Jakub Sawicki told broadcaster TVP.

“While in the apartment, one of the women would grab the attention of the man – basically showing him a good time – while the second woman would loot the place,” he added.

The cat burglars managed to accumulate over PLN 12,000 before being accosted by the police.

So far ten men have stepped forward to the authorities in connection with the incidents, although the police think that there may be many more cases. (jb)
